Thank you

Thank you for submitting your details. Click below to download your documents.
Is your business fast enough?
How retailers delivered peak 2021
A survey of over 100 retailers on the shape of peak 2021 and their outlook for the year ahead.
logo amazon shipping
© 1996-2024,, Inc. or its affiliates. All rights reserved.